Transaction 568cd06cab3eca2a84581f80c4915214658ca39edf9b2a949c02fd0a9604583b
1 Input
1 Output
-
568cd06cab3eca2a84581f80c4915214658ca39edf9b2a949c02fd0a9604583b:0
- value
- 758582
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4855975df530a04901fb55ce5043e2737aa15918 OP_EQUAL
- address
- 38HV7LmvgH64zuatyrntVHwzTbjNtbJNb4